Been noticing this quite a bit lately, especially through this miserable grey winter we've had in Cornwall. My Victron SmartSolar 100/30 seems to harvest almost nothing on overcast days even when there's clearly some usable light about — the kind of flat white sky that should still be giving decent diffuse irradiance.

I've got a 400W array on the shepherd's hut and I'm wondering whether the issue is partly that my panels are sized too conservatively relative to what the MPPT can actually track efficiently at low light levels. I've read that some controllers struggle to find the true MPP when input voltage is low and inconsistent, which is basically every British winter morning ever.

A few questions for those who've dug into this:

  • Does array oversizing actually help here? I've seen people running 150-200% of their controller's rated wattage and claiming better low-light performance
  • Is this more a panel quality issue — would better low-light response panels (some of the half-cut cell ones seem promising) make a meaningful difference?
  • Has anyone tried reorienting panels to catch more diffuse sky rather than optimising for direct sun angles?

I'm also running a small setup on the boat and seeing the same pattern there, so it doesn't feel like a one-off installation issue.

Would be really interested to hear what others have found, particularly anyone who's done before/after comparisons after changing their array size or controller. Does the Victron actually log enough data through the VictronConnect app to properly diagnose this, or do people tend to use something more detailed?

@CornishBoater yeah this is a known thing with MPPT in low light — the panel voltage can drop below the controller's start threshold so it just sits there doing nothing useful.

Few things worth trying:

  • Tilt your panels steeper — diffuse light comes more from overhead, steeper angle helps in winter
  • Check your Victron app, there's a minimum panel voltage setting — make sure it's not set too conservatively
  • More panels in series bumps the Voc up which helps the controller actually wake up properly on dull days

My setup's purely emergency backup so I've got mine wired for higher voltage rather than higher amps specifically because of this issue — cloudy day performance improved noticeably.

Cornwall in January is basically a worst-case scenario for solar tbh, not much you can do about the physics of it.

@CornishBoater worth checking your panel Voc vs your battery voltage — on really flat grey days I've seen my array voltage barely creep above what the controller needs to actually kick in and start tracking.

On my cabin setup I've got a Victron SmartSolar 75/15 running 2x 200w panels and honestly in deep winter it sometimes just... sits there blinking at me doing sod all until around 10am even when it's technically "daylight."

One thing that helped me was adjusting the absorption voltage down slightly so the controller wasn't chasing a target it couldn't reach — seemed to wake it up a bit faster in low light.

Also check the VRM app if you're using it, the detailed graphs show exactly when it starts harvesting. Mine was eye-opening — losing a good couple of hours each end of the day I hadn't accounted for.

@CornishBoater something worth digging into is the panel wiring configuration — if you're running panels in parallel on a 12V system, your array voltage on a grim overcast day might barely clear the Victron's minimum start threshold.

I had exactly this on the narrowboat before I rewired two of my panels into series. Went from almost nothing harvesting on grey days to a meaningful trickle. The SmartSolar needs roughly battery voltage + a few volts overhead to actually engage properly.

Also worth enabling the "Advanced" logging in VictorConnect — look at the "Panel voltage" graph and see whether it's actually tracking or just sitting idle. Sometimes the controller is working but the harvest is genuinely that dismal (welcome to a UK winter 😅).

What's your panel layout — series, parallel, or mixed?
